Oyo: Police say two suspected armed robbers nabbed, stolen vehicles recovered

The police command in Oyo state has nabbed two armed robbery suspects, following credible intelligence and a manhunt.
The arrest of the suspects was the result of a well-coordinated, intelligence-led operation conducted by police personnel attached to the command’s monitoring unit, according to a statement by its spokesman, Ayanlade Olayinka, on Wednesday.
The suspects, David Okhaie (48), a dismissed corporal of the Nigerian Army with service number 2005NA, and Balogun Afolabi (43), a corporal dismissed from the army with service number 2011NA, specialised in gunpoint robbery, the police stated.
“Investigations revealed that the suspects specialised in dispossessing unsuspecting members of the public of their vehicles at gunpoint, thereby instilling fear and disrupting public peace within the state,” the statement said.
It added, “One Toyota Camry, black in colour, with registration number KRD 253 KC; one Toyota Corolla, metallic in colour, with registration number JTA 938 AA; one Lexus RX350, silver in colour, unregistered; and one Super Cargo motorcycle, black in colour, with registration number YRE 487 VD were recovered from the suspects.
“In view of the above recoveries, the command hereby invites members of the public who may have lost their vehicles to armed robbery or theft, and whose vehicle descriptions match any of the recovered exhibits, to come forward to the Oyo state police command with valid proof of ownership and means of identification for verification and possible claim of their vehicles.”
